The 2008 Yamaha FZ1 a cutting edge sport bike with a twist. Unlike most other machines in this class, the FZ1 features state of the art engine and chassis designs. The ultimate street brawler brings 998cc of fuel-injected previous generation R1 power to the fray, in a light and strong aluminum frame. Crunch the numbers, do the math and then take a seat aboard the world's best naked sport bike. Surprisingly comfortable eh? You are looking at 1 of the best values in Yamaha's 2008 line-up. The FZ1 offers exceptional open class performance with cutting style. R1 inspired power, fuel injection, twin spar aluminum frame and fully adjustable suspension. The FZ1 is a serious sport bike that offers an exceptionally comfortable and exciting riding experience. 2011 World Supersport Champion Chaz Davies

Mon, 03 Oct 2011

Chaz Davies has captured the 2011 Supersport World Championship, completing a triumphant return to the series for Yamaha. Davies, the 2008 Daytona 200 winner, finished the Magny-Cours round in sixth place, giving him an insurmountable 35-point lead over Hannspree Ten Kate Honda‘s Fabien Foret with one race remaining. The championship comes in Yamaha‘s return from a one-year absence from the series.
